English

Etymology

From Middle English *atrouten, atruten, ætruten, equivalent to at- +‎ rout (to rush, beat, assail).

Verb

atrout (third-person singular simple present atrouts, present participle atrouting, simple past and past participle atrouted)

  1. (intransitive, obsolete) To rush away; escape.
